Ingredients:
1 13 oz Hayman's London Dry Gin
12 oz Strucchi Red Bitter (Campari-style liqueur)
13 oz Rothman & Winter Crème de Violette Liqueur
12 oz Lime juice (freshly squeezed)
13 oz Honey syrup (3 parts honey to 1 water by weight)
× 1 1 serving
Read about cocktail measures and measuring

How to make:

  1. Select and pre-chill an Old-fashioned glass.
  2. Prepare garnish of orange slice wheel..
  3. SHAKE all ingredients with ice.
  4. FINE STRAIN into chilled glass.
  5. Garnish with orange slice wheel.

Review:

The original recipe is closer to equal parts, but I find the floral and bitter notes overpowering, so I've reined back somewhat in this interpretation.

History:

Adapted from a recipe created in 2015 by the team at Angeline in New Orleans, Louisiana (shuttered June 2018).
